It is nice to see folks experimenting widely with unique visual representations of agent orchestration, as a consequence of the bottom-up / individual-led development that's driving the industry (inasmuch as it exists yet). There are folks young enough now that they've never known anything other than "the desktop" (or CLI) as a computing metaphor. But there's no fundamental reason a metaphor has to be anything specific... it should be whatever is most widely comprehensible and efficient for the problem space. | ||
